This modern-day take on Jane Austens Emma was set in 1990s Beverly Hills and written and directed by Amy Heckerling. Alicia Silverstone plays the ultra-rich and privileged Cher, one of the most popular girls at her high school. She has a delightful heart, but shes clueless subsequently it comes to not judging a book by its cover. Stacey Dash plays Chers best friend, Dionne, and Brittany Murphy is Tai, the further other girl in moot and Chers additional project Cher feels Tai needs a makeover and better taste in boys.
Theres also a storyline in which the young person Cher ends taking place in the works bodily attracted to her college-aged ex-step-brother Josh (Paul Rudd), which hasnt necessarily aged well. But Clueless is yet nevertheless a unchanging everlasting next it comes to objector 90s tech (brick cell phones and software that coordinates your outfits), fashion (matching plaid skirts and blazers!) and slang.
Richard Linklater (Boyhood) directed and co-wrote this tale very nearly the American tourist Jesse (Ethan Hawke) and the French Cline (Julie Delpy). They meet not far off from a Eurail train and adjudicate to debark in Vienna and spend one night together chatting and getting to know the city and one another. The romantic film is basically a series of conversations amid the two pubescent people and their reflections not far off from life.
In real valid Linklater fashion, the filmmaker reunited following Delpy and Hawke entirely decade for the sequels Before Sunset (2004) and ahead of time Midnight (2013) that other explore the attachment in the company of Jesse and Cline.
